This two-bedroom terraced house is offered for sale in good condition and with no vendor chain, making it suitable for first-time buyers and investors. Located in the popular town of Glossop, the property benefits from a convenient position close to public transport links, nearby schools and a range of local amenities.
The ground floor comprises a lounge featuring a fireplace, providing a focal point for the living space. To the rear, the kitchen offers a good range of units and dining space, creating a practical area for everyday cooking and meals. Upstairs, there are two double bedrooms and a bathroom with a four piece suite including a bath and separate shower.
Glossop town centre offers a selection of supermarkets, independent shops, cafés and pubs, as well as leisure facilities and access to nearby parks and open spaces on the edge of the Peak District. Local primary and secondary schools are within easy reach, appealing to households needing access to education.
Public transport connections are a key feature of this location. Glossop railway station provides regular services to Manchester Piccadilly, with typical journey times of around 30–35 minutes, making the property suitable for those commuting into the city. Bus routes through Glossop offer links to surrounding towns and villages, including Hadfield and Hyde.
Overall, this two-bedroom terraced house for sale presents a practical layout in a convenient Glossop location, with good access to transport, schools and amenities.
